Transaction 29904fd22b4332a91b723c7c307917edabfbbae92a392f23e293c816f44e2a4a

1 Input
2 Outputs
  • 29904fd22b4332a91b723c7c307917edabfbbae92a392f23e293c816f44e2a4a:0
  • value  10569615
    address  3CEFmnD9B7F5CUGFXYMwNkqjeBXHgUE7wG
  • 29904fd22b4332a91b723c7c307917edabfbbae92a392f23e293c816f44e2a4a:1
  • value  2805000
    address  137iCzyPxgM3jvARNVSUud4VTHinkfmupv